Willard council to consider rezoning property from R1/2 to MPC (Ordinance 2025-18)

The Sept. 25 agenda includes approval of Ordinance 2025-18 amending the official Zoning Map to rezone certain property from R1/2 to MPC; the agenda does not include the property address, map, or vote results.

The Willard City Council’s Sept. 25, 2025, agenda includes “Approval of Ordinance 2025-18 Amending the official Zoning Map of Willard City by rezoning certain property from R1/2 to MPC.” The item is scheduled under New Business at the 6:30 p.m. meeting at Willard City Offices, 80 W. 50 S.

The agenda identifies the ordinance number and the rezoning from R1/2 (a residential district) to MPC (a mixed-planned community or similarly named district implied by the MPC acronym), but it does not provide the specific property description, map exhibit, staff report, or the reading stage (first reading, final adoption). The agenda also does not show a recorded vote or final outcome.

Because the agenda lacks the ordinance text and supporting documents, it notifies the public that the council will consider a rezoning ordinance but does not show whether the council adopted, amended, or rejected the change.
